Slope Intercept Form from 2 Points: (6,6) and (8,-8) "Show work"
JulsSmile [24]

Answer:

the desired equation is y = -7x + 48

Step-by-step explanation:

As we go from (6, 6) to (8, -8), x (the "run") increases by 2 while y (the "rise") increases by 14.  Thus, the slope is m = rise/run = -14/2 = -7.

The slope intercept form of the equation of a straight line is y = mx + b.  Here we need to find b.

y = mx + b becomes 6 = -7(6) + b, or 48 = b.

Thus, the desired equation is y = -7x + 48
